Closeouts. Lowa’s AL-T Orix low-profile trail shoes have a durable, sturdy outsole and supportive midsole that anchors the foot in place so you’ll be sure stepping no matter how unstable the terrain.

    This is my first pair of Lowa shoes and I am already impressed with the build quality. A bit stiff at first, you will need to allow a few days of break-in. Sizing runs a size small - I normally wear a 13 - 13.5 and found the 14 (US) to be a good fit. The initial stiffness of the shoe concerned me but after wearing them around the house the first day, I quickly discovered they need time to conform to my foot. I have had them about two weeks now and wear them everyday in a combination of urban terrain and dry backwoods. I would not suggest wearing them for long periods of cold or wet conditions as they are more of a warm weather shoe, well vented and light - too light for cold winter days. I would definitely recommend them and look forward to having them a long time.
